another quiet day, but just for an interest im going to have a NOEL FEILHY day at Uttoxeter on wednesday.

He has 3 booked rides.

3.25 HELLFIRE CLUB 3rd @ 11/1
5.35 CHAIN OF COMMAND 2nd @ 9/4

These two hail from the Malcolm Denmark owned yard. He has put a new trainer in residence called WJ GREATEAUX, its not a name im familiar with, indeed i bet i have spelt his surname wrong!

His first runner as a trainer was sent off a well backed 11/4 shot & was bang there until slipping & unseating Noel Feilhy, i would presume he is keen in knocking in a first winner for Mr Denmark his landlord, who has supplied Carl Llewlyn & Mark Pitman before him, some choicely bred national hunt types. HELLFIRE CLUB re-appears after an absence of 750+ days off when he was owned by Barry O'Connell the amateur jockey and business man from Ireland, who also liked to have horses with Mark Pitman and Carl Llewlyn, interesting he has sold him & the horse has been kept in training. CHAIN OF COMMAND is a FTO bumper horse. Back in the day, the yard used to like introducing useful types at midlands tracks before stepping them up in grade, so he is worth watching/betting in the concluding bumper for clues regarding his ability.

5.05 DENNY MAC unplaced

Gandolfo trained chaser, who had modest form in ireland & has shown modest handicapping chase form in this country also, the hook for me is the step back to 2m on a sharp track, i would expect the jockey to ride him handy and make use of his stamina.
